logo

Output 95ea947b615a34abaf971fc397f493a378c5388e23a752d71c8b3670c57ee04b:3

value
767160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 095cf5bce5835c15a3f8db82cae177396b6394ba OP_EQUAL
address
32YXNEmkP2eEJBcTkGtCzToNiHWGwaqYMM
transaction
95ea947b615a34abaf971fc397f493a378c5388e23a752d71c8b3670c57ee04b